(above) "Rocko" gets a friend. Alliance, Nebraska, November 2007: I made the return trip to Alliance to visit my brother and family, and perform some more artist-in-residence projects. The first order of business was to create another mascot for the high school. Last year's "rocko" the bulldog went so well that it was decided to create a female companion for him. I created the armature for "Rochelle" in my brother's workshop and once again the art classes at the high school layered the sculpture with different types of paper. The last coat of white is our way of recycling old test papers and such.  Thank you to Medelice Wirtz for the photos of Rocko and Rochelle.
